Go to Wallet and select your PayPal balance and click Set as Preferred on the right.

 

If you have monthly subscriptions, go to Account Settings (wheel icon) > Payments > Manage Automatic Payments, select merchant and on the right, you can check if the correct payment method is set.

 

Also when checking out, always review your payment before completing checkout to make sure the right payment method is used. Click the "Change" link to select another payment method, if not.

 

Also try clearing out your browser cache and cookies and restart device and attempt the purchase again. Also make sure you have the latest version of the browser.
